技術(shù)頻道

娓娓工業(yè)
您現(xiàn)在的位置: 中國傳動(dòng)網(wǎng) > 技術(shù)頻道 > 應(yīng)用方案 > 基于臺(tái)達(dá)PLC和變頻器的位置控制的實(shí)現(xiàn)

基于臺(tái)達(dá)PLC和變頻器的位置控制的實(shí)現(xiàn)

時(shí)間:2010-03-22 16:16:05來源:ronggang

導(dǎo)語:?本文講述利用臺(tái)達(dá)PLC和變頻器通過通訊功能實(shí)現(xiàn)的定位控制的應(yīng)用。通過此案例講述了PLC的高速計(jì)數(shù)器的使用方法和PLC和變頻器的通訊的實(shí)現(xiàn)

摘 要:本文講述利用臺(tái)達(dá)PLC變頻器通過通訊功能實(shí)現(xiàn)的定位控制的應(yīng)用。通過此案例講述了PLC的高速計(jì)數(shù)器的使用方法和PLC和變頻器的通訊的實(shí)現(xiàn)。

關(guān)鍵詞:PLC 變頻器 高速計(jì)數(shù)器 通訊 定位控制

Abstract: The paper introduce the position control with Delta’s PLC and Inverter which use the Communication function。Also in this paper presents the application of the PLC’s High-speed counter and communication with Inverter。

KEY WORD: PLC Inverter High-speed Counter Communication Position control

1 引言

  當(dāng)今自動(dòng)化控制產(chǎn)品日新月異,相同功能的實(shí)現(xiàn)有各種各樣不同的方式。比如很多設(shè)備上都要使用的定位控制的實(shí)現(xiàn)就有很多種方法。有的利用單片機(jī)結(jié)合伺服系統(tǒng)實(shí)現(xiàn)定位控制;有的使用PLC高速脈沖輸出功能或配定位單元結(jié)合伺服系統(tǒng)實(shí)現(xiàn);還有的利用變頻器的多段速控制來實(shí)現(xiàn)定位控制。但不同的定位控制系統(tǒng)有不同的特點(diǎn),成本也有很大的差異,于是針對(duì)不同的設(shè)備對(duì)精度和響應(yīng)速度的要求,選用合適的定位控制系統(tǒng)以實(shí)現(xiàn)最優(yōu)的性價(jià)比就非常必要。本文介紹一個(gè)高性價(jià)比的,應(yīng)用臺(tái)達(dá)PLC的高速計(jì)數(shù)器和與變頻器通訊的功能來實(shí)現(xiàn)的定位控制的例子。

2 控制實(shí)例

  切紙機(jī)械是印刷和包裝行業(yè)最常用的設(shè)備。其完成的最基本動(dòng)作是:把待裁切的材料送到指定位置,然后進(jìn)行裁切。其控制的核心就是一個(gè)單軸的位置控制。我們已經(jīng)成功的利用PLC對(duì)變頻器的端子進(jìn)行控制,實(shí)現(xiàn)多段速調(diào)速,從而完成這個(gè)單軸控制。因?yàn)榭紤]到控制成本和操作的方便性,我們又應(yīng)用臺(tái)達(dá)的ES PLC和VFD-B變頻器通過通訊來實(shí)現(xiàn)這個(gè)位置控制。

3 系統(tǒng)的構(gòu)成

  PLC作為控制的核心,主要用來接收編碼器的反饋信號(hào)實(shí)現(xiàn)對(duì)當(dāng)前位置的檢測(cè),通過和設(shè)定值的比較用通訊功能來控制變頻器的輸出頻率從而實(shí)現(xiàn)精確定位。同時(shí)通過HMI可以方便的設(shè)定PLC的一些內(nèi)部寄存器值進(jìn)行人機(jī)交互,并且變頻器的工作頻率可以在HMI上方便修改和直觀顯示。臺(tái)達(dá)的DVP系列PLC都具有兩個(gè)通訊口,COM1是RS232,COM2是RS485,支持ModBus ASCII/RTU通訊格式,通訊速率最高可達(dá)115200bps,兩通訊口可以同時(shí)使用。所以無需用任何擴(kuò)展模塊就可以實(shí)現(xiàn)既可連接用于參數(shù)設(shè)置的人機(jī)界面又可用通訊的方式控制變頻器等其它設(shè)備。并且DVP系列PLC提供了針對(duì)ModBus ASCII/RTU模式的專用通訊指令,這樣在編寫通訊程序時(shí)就可以大大簡(jiǎn)化,無需像用串行數(shù)據(jù)傳送指令RS那樣要進(jìn)行復(fù)雜的校驗(yàn)碼計(jì)算和遵循復(fù)雜的指令格式。臺(tái)達(dá)的VFD系列變頻器內(nèi)建有單獨(dú)的RS-485串聯(lián)通訊界面,并且也遵循MODBUS ASCII/RTU通訊格式(VFD-A系列除外)?;c這些特點(diǎn)我選用了性價(jià)比優(yōu)異的DVP ES PLC和VFD-B變頻器。整個(gè)系統(tǒng)的結(jié)構(gòu)圖如圖一所示。

控制系統(tǒng)框圖

圖一:控制系統(tǒng)框圖

4 PLC的I/O分配

  由于使用了通訊控制,可以省去用于控制變頻器的五個(gè)輸出點(diǎn),PLC輸出點(diǎn)的使用減少了。因此選用了DVP14ES00R2和一個(gè)擴(kuò)展模塊DVP08XM11N。I/O點(diǎn)的分配見表1。需要注意的是DVP14ES PLC的擴(kuò)展模塊地址輸入點(diǎn)是從X20開始,輸出點(diǎn)是從Y20開始。

  表1:PLC I/O分配表

輸入點(diǎn)

意義

輸出點(diǎn)

意義

x0

脈沖輸入A

y0

壓板上

x1

脈沖輸入B

y1

進(jìn)給離合

x2

前限位

y2

壓板下

x3

后限位

y3

刀離合

x4

前減速位

y4

電機(jī)禁啟動(dòng)

x5

備用

y5

 

x6

刀凸輪

 

 

x7

刀上位感應(yīng)

 

 

X20

壓紙器上位

 

 

X21

連桿光電保護(hù)

 

 

X22

備用

 

 

X23

雙手下刀按鈕

 

 

X24

停止按鈕

 

 

X25

變頻器故障

 

 

X26

后退

 

 

X27

前進(jìn)

 

 

5 ES系列PLC的高速計(jì)數(shù)器的應(yīng)用

  此工程中所選編碼器分辨率為500p/r,機(jī)器原系統(tǒng)配置編碼器分辨率為200p/r,理論精度比過去提高兩倍以上。電機(jī)為1450r/min,傳動(dòng)系統(tǒng)減速比為2.4。由此可計(jì)算出額定轉(zhuǎn)速下編碼器輸出的最高脈沖頻率為:

  1450r/min÷60s/min÷2.4×500P/R≈5KHz。

  盡管臺(tái)達(dá)ES系列的高速計(jì)數(shù)器功能不算強(qiáng)大,其X0和X1可以接受的最高頻率為20K Hz的脈沖,但在這個(gè)系統(tǒng)中還是足以勝任的。為了簡(jiǎn)化程序中的計(jì)算,采用了兩個(gè)高速計(jì)數(shù)器C235和C236。C235通過計(jì)算所有前進(jìn)后退的脈沖數(shù),再進(jìn)行換算后用于顯示進(jìn)給機(jī)構(gòu)的當(dāng)前位置,此功能實(shí)現(xiàn)的程序段見圖2所示。其程序中的M45和M47用于濾除定位完成后裁切過程中或其它震動(dòng)造成的編碼器輸出的誤脈沖,以實(shí)現(xiàn)位置的精確性。

實(shí)現(xiàn)顯示當(dāng)前位置的高速計(jì)數(shù)程序段

圖2:實(shí)現(xiàn)顯示當(dāng)前位置的高速計(jì)數(shù)程序段

  C236用于進(jìn)行精確定位。定位過程是這樣的,每次進(jìn)給機(jī)構(gòu)需要定位工作時(shí),通過計(jì)算把需要的脈沖數(shù)送到C236,不論進(jìn)給機(jī)構(gòu)前進(jìn)還是后退,C236進(jìn)行減計(jì)數(shù),同時(shí)對(duì)C236中的數(shù)值進(jìn)行比較,根據(jù)比較結(jié)果控制變頻器的輸出頻率,實(shí)現(xiàn)接近設(shè)定值時(shí)進(jìn)給速度變慢的三段速度控制,從而達(dá)到精確定位。精確定位時(shí)的高速計(jì)數(shù)器程序如圖3所示。其中M83、M84用來觸發(fā)寫變頻器運(yùn)轉(zhuǎn)方向的數(shù)據(jù),M85、M86,M87都用來觸發(fā)寫變頻器運(yùn)轉(zhuǎn)速度的數(shù)據(jù)。

定位控制時(shí)的高速計(jì)數(shù)器程序

圖3:定位控制時(shí)的高速計(jì)數(shù)器程序

6 PLC和變頻器通訊的實(shí)現(xiàn)

  臺(tái)達(dá)DVP系列PLC的每一個(gè)通訊口都對(duì)應(yīng)有相關(guān)的特殊寄存器D和特殊繼電器M,以進(jìn)行通訊相關(guān)的參數(shù)設(shè)置和信息的傳送。此工程中要使用的COM2對(duì)應(yīng)的主要特D特M及其意義見表2。

  表2:特殊寄存器和特殊繼電器的意義

 

編號(hào)

意義

 

D

D1120

RS-485通訊協(xié)議設(shè)定

D1129

通訊逾時(shí)時(shí)間設(shè)定,當(dāng)一筆通訊時(shí)間超過此設(shè)定值將會(huì)出現(xiàn)通訊逾時(shí)錯(cuò)誤

 

 

 

 

 

M

M1120

通訊設(shè)置保持,通訊參數(shù)設(shè)置后需在程序中設(shè)置此位ON

M1122

請(qǐng)求通信開始信號(hào),開始通訊時(shí)需要用程序設(shè)置此位為ON,通訊完成后PLC會(huì)自動(dòng)將此位OFF

M1129

通訊逾時(shí)時(shí)PLC產(chǎn)生的信號(hào),需編程復(fù)位

M1140

MODRD/MODWR/MODRW數(shù)據(jù)接收錯(cuò)誤信號(hào)

M1141

MODRD/MODWR/MODRW數(shù)據(jù)指令參數(shù)錯(cuò)誤信號(hào)

M1143

ASCII/RTU模式選擇,OFF時(shí)為ASCII,ON時(shí)為RTU模式

  此工程中變頻器需要設(shè)定的參數(shù)及說明見表3。在進(jìn)行變頻器的通訊控制時(shí)必需設(shè)定這些參數(shù),并且設(shè)定值要和PLC的D1120值設(shè)置一致。其它未設(shè)置的參數(shù)可以按出廠默認(rèn)值即可。

  表3:變頻器參數(shù)設(shè)置表

參數(shù)號(hào)

設(shè)定值

說明

01-09

0.5s

此兩個(gè)參數(shù)為加減速時(shí)間,為了實(shí)現(xiàn)快速高效的定位,在保證變頻器不出錯(cuò)的情況下盡量設(shè)小點(diǎn)

01-10

0.3s

02-00

05

指定第一頻率指令由RS-485通訊輸入

02-01

03

指定運(yùn)轉(zhuǎn)指令由RS-485通訊操作

09-00

01

變頻器的通訊地址定義為1

09-01

01

通訊傳送速率定義為9600

09-04

03

通訊資料格式定義為8,N,2for RTU

  當(dāng)PLC對(duì)變頻器通訊進(jìn)行數(shù)據(jù)的寫入和讀出時(shí),就需要知道變頻器所定義的相關(guān)功能的地址。然后依據(jù)這些地址進(jìn)行數(shù)據(jù)寫入和讀出,才能實(shí)現(xiàn)對(duì)變頻器的控制。VFD-B系列變頻器定義的本通訊實(shí)例中需用到的字址及其意義如表4所示。根據(jù)此表可以知道,當(dāng)需要變頻器以20Hz正向運(yùn)轉(zhuǎn)時(shí),就只需在變頻器通訊相關(guān)的參數(shù)字址2000H寫入:0000 0000 0001 0010,即十六進(jìn)制的H12或十進(jìn)制的K18;在2001H中寫入K2000。

  表4:變頻器的通訊參數(shù)字址定義

定義

參數(shù)地址

功能說明

變頻器

待寫入地

址意義

 

PLC可以通過通訊程序向此位置寫入數(shù)據(jù)

         2000H

Bit0-1

00B:無功能

01B:停止

10B: 啟動(dòng)

11B:JOG啟動(dòng)

Bit2-3

保留

Bit4-5

00B:無功能

01B:正方向指令

10B:反方向指令

11B:改變方向指令

Bit6-15

保留

2001H

頻率命令 例:

當(dāng)希望變頻器輸出頻率為20Hz時(shí)可寫入2000,5Hz時(shí)寫入500,以此類推。

  此工程中通訊程序段如圖4所示。

工程中通訊程序段

7 結(jié)論

  通過上述的改造過程,完全恢復(fù)了切紙機(jī)的功能,試用幾個(gè)月以來運(yùn)行非常穩(wěn)定。PLC對(duì)變頻器的通訊控制響應(yīng)速度非??欤訙p速的過程和停機(jī)命令執(zhí)行迅速,完全不會(huì)因通訊控制而有絲毫遲滯現(xiàn)象,可見通訊控制完全替代了硬接線的端子控制,不僅降低了成本,而且操作更方便,性價(jià)比更優(yōu)異。也證明了臺(tái)達(dá)的PLC和變頻器的通訊功能非常強(qiáng)大和好用。

參考文獻(xiàn):

  1.PLC應(yīng)用技術(shù)手冊(cè)(程序篇),中達(dá)電通

  2. VFD-B變頻器手冊(cè),中達(dá)電通

標(biāo)簽:

點(diǎn)贊

分享到:

上一篇:為國產(chǎn)風(fēng)電變流器廠家提供PRO...

下一篇:微能WIN-V63矢量控制變頻器在...

中國傳動(dòng)網(wǎng)版權(quán)與免責(zé)聲明:凡本網(wǎng)注明[來源:中國傳動(dòng)網(wǎng)]的所有文字、圖片、音視和視頻文件,版權(quán)均為中國傳動(dòng)網(wǎng)(www.wangxinlc.cn)獨(dú)家所有。如需轉(zhuǎn)載請(qǐng)與0755-82949061聯(lián)系。任何媒體、網(wǎng)站或個(gè)人轉(zhuǎn)載使用時(shí)須注明來源“中國傳動(dòng)網(wǎng)”,違反者本網(wǎng)將追究其法律責(zé)任。

本網(wǎng)轉(zhuǎn)載并注明其他來源的稿件,均來自互聯(lián)網(wǎng)或業(yè)內(nèi)投稿人士,版權(quán)屬于原版權(quán)人。轉(zhuǎn)載請(qǐng)保留稿件來源及作者,禁止擅自篡改,違者自負(fù)版權(quán)法律責(zé)任。

網(wǎng)站簡(jiǎn)介|會(huì)員服務(wù)|聯(lián)系方式|幫助信息|版權(quán)信息|網(wǎng)站地圖|友情鏈接|法律支持|意見反饋|sitemap

傳動(dòng)網(wǎng)-工業(yè)自動(dòng)化與智能制造的全媒體“互聯(lián)網(wǎng)+”創(chuàng)新服務(wù)平臺(tái)

網(wǎng)站客服服務(wù)咨詢采購咨詢媒體合作

Chuandong.com Copyright ?2005 - 2025 ,All Rights Reserved 深圳市奧美大唐廣告有限公司 版權(quán)所有
粵ICP備 14004826號(hào) | 營業(yè)執(zhí)照證書 | 不良信息舉報(bào)中心 | 粵公網(wǎng)安備 44030402000946號(hào)